Vianode AS is owned by world-leading industrial and financial companies Hydro, and Altor. We aim to become a leading solutions provider to the fast-growing battery industry.

Our advanced anode graphite is a key component in the production of lithium-ion batteries and contributes to increased range for electric vehicles, faster charging, long life, and improved safety.

Our first industrial plant for the production of anode graphite is built in Norway, and the start of production is planned in 2024. The next phase large-scale plant is in the planning stage and aims to be in production in 2026.
